Brazilian postal service has been declining in quality for about a decade, when the e-commerce fever started here. And don't think that I and other people didn't tried to change this: Brazilian post is government-run, with all bureaucracy implicit by this.

Do you want to know their official position? I know that because of previous experiences: the standard estimate for delivery of international non-express packages (the tracking code starts with R, just like the one Shadovved used) is 60 business days starting from the day the package arrives in Brazil. Complication: the packages must go through customs, which is another public service, from a distinct government department.

Truth be told: Brazilian government is using postal import taxes as a way to increase revenue. It is a flat 60% tax over package value + shipping. And I read in some news that Brazilian post receives about 2 million packages per month, without an infrastructure to support this volume of work.

I'll finish with an example that happened to me this week: last Tuesday I received a book (one of the few items that can not be import taxed by Brazilian law) that I bought on Amazon UK. I purchased it in November 2014. It took so long to be delivered that I asked for a refund on Amazon UK and bought it again on Amazon US (they use a shipping company with their own fleet called i-Parcel. Only when it arrives in Brazil they use local post service to make final delivery).

That's different from my issue, mine catch on the way down if I press them even a little off center (on the side towards me, the side of the switch farthest from me is fine). The key stops for a moment and makes a pretty loud ka-thunk sound.. really unpleasant. It turned out to be nearly all of my switches, out of 200 I have like 30 that don't catch. They come back up just fine though.

The fix for me was to file down the edge of the switch top with a small round file, but it takes forever to do it. I did all 40 switch tops on my JD40 and it took me like four hours to do.. and some of them are still grindy and scratchy feeling. Really unimpressed to be honest, I can't use these on my next Phantom build unless I use cheap keycaps or spend an entire day filing to end up with some switches that are way scratchier than Cherrys. It's a shame, because I was excited to use these, and I kind of feel like I wasted $50. The few that don't catch feel great.
